Re: [Dovecot] dovecot.sieve file location?
kbajwa [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: 2. '.dovecot.sieve' script parameter :days 1 means that the reply is sent once a day. Is it possible to send the reply 'immediately'? AIUI it /is/ sent immediately, but the same user only gets one reply per {period} of time. Chris
